Human gamete fusion can bypass β1 integrin requirement

Since α6β1 integrin has been shown to function as a sperm adhesion receptor in the mouse, we investigated the potential role of β1 integrin in the gamete fusion process in humans. The expression of β1 integrin was morphologically analysed by indirect immunofluorescence and confocal microscopy.
